Exti_inittypedef
Web目录一、定时器相关代码1、tim22、tim3和tim4二、中断相关代码三、电机相关代码四、oled屏幕和mup6050相关代码五、pid函数1、直立环2、速度环3、转向环六、控制函数七、扩展篇说明:本篇文章适用于有点stm32单片机基础,和有相关的硬件基础,并且想做一个小 … WebDec 12, 2012 · void. EXTI_Init ( EXTI_InitTypeDef *EXTI_InitStruct) Initializes the EXTI peripheral according to the specified parameters in the EXTI_InitStruct. EXTI_Line …
Exti_inittypedef
Did you know?
WebSep 12, 2024 · The STM32F105 is a Cortex-M3-based microcontroller. It supports nested interrupts. My application is written in C, using GCC (arm-none-eabi-gcc) in Eclipse, with the STM32F1 Standard Peripheral Library. I think I have the priorities configured correctly but I must be missing something. Here is the corresponding initialization code. WebJun 7, 2015 · I have faced another strange thing today: inside ISR of EXTI I wanted to send some character to USART, but I found that program halts there, after eliminating the commands regarding USART I found that program waits to reset USART_FLAG_TXE, but the flag remains in set mode. when I eliminated below command, program runs forward …
WebEXTI_InitTypeDef and NVIC_InitTypeDef not recognized. I set up several pins as EXTI in the CubeMX configurator, but STM32CubeIDE doesn't recognize the EXTI_InitTypeDef …
WebJun 22, 2012 · EXTI_InitTypeDef * EXTI_InitStruct ) Initializes the EXTI peripheral according to the specified parameters in the EXTI_InitStruct. Parameters: EXTI_InitStruct,: pointer to a EXTI_InitTypeDef structure that contains the configuration information for the EXTI peripheral. Return values: None void EXTI_StructInit ( EXTI_InitTypeDef * … WebQuestion: 1. To enable an interrupt, software needs to enable the interrupt. Software needs to perform two operations: enable the corresponding interrupt of the Cortex-M interrupt controller (NVIC), and enable the interrupt of the corresponding peripheral (set the Interrupt Mask Register).
WebJan 3, 2024 · EXTI_InitTypeDef EXTI_InitStructure; NVIC_InitTypeDef NVIC_InitStructure; uint8_t Pinx; if (! IS_PIN (Pin)) return; Pinx = GPIO_GetPinNum (Pin); if (Pinx > 15) return; EXTI_Function [Pinx] = function; //GPIO中断线以及中断初始化配置 RCC_APB2PeriphClockCmd (RCC_APB2Periph_SYSCFG, ENABLE);
WebApr 13, 2024 · 中断寄存器. ISER [8],Interrupt Set-Enable Registers,中断使能寄存器组,用8个32位寄存器控制 (256个可编程中断),每个位控制一个中断。. 由于STM32f103 … ruth zale obituaryWeb* @param EXTI_InitStruct: pointer to a EXTI_InitTypeDef structure * that contains the configuration information for the EXTI peripheral. * @retval None */ void EXTI_Init(EXTI_InitTypeDef* EXTI_InitStruct) {uint32_t tmp = 0; /* Check the parameters */ is chewing ice bad for dogsWebEXTI_InitStruct->EXTI_Trigger = EXTI_Trigger_Falling; EXTI_InitStruct->EXTI_LineCmd = DISABLE;} /** * @brief Generates a Software interrupt on selected EXTI line. * @param … ruth zadikany mayer brownWebHello, I am studying the STM32F4xx_DSP_StdPeriph_Lib and I am trying to understand how to handleEXTI0 interrupts using the STM32F4xx Discovery Board. The firmware should execute the interrupt when the GPIOA0 is triggered (in this case with the User button) and sequentially toggle the GPIOD [12:15] pins. is chewing ice bad for uWebApr 6, 2024 · 互联网的广大网友,大家早上中午晚上好、EXTI、、、故名思义、、EX表外,出、、I表示Intrrupt、、所以合起来就是外部中断、、、说到这、、我觉得我最近的六 … is chewing ice a sign of sexual frustrationWebJan 4, 2024 · III Introduction to EXTI. 1. EXTI external interrupt. 2. EXTI can monitor the level signal of the specified GPIO port. When the level of the GPIO port changes, EXTI will immediately send an interrupt application to the NVIC. After the decision of the NVIC, let the CPU execute the interrupt program. 3. is chewbacca in fortniteWebMar 9, 2024 · EXTI_Init (EXTI_InitTypeDef* EXTI_InitStruct); 1 Judge whether the interrupt state of the interrupt line occurs EXTI_GetITStatus (uint32_t EXTI_Line); 1 Clear the interrupt flag bit on the interrupt line EXTI_ClearITPendingBit (uint32_t EXTI_Line); 1 General configuration steps for external interrupts ruth yusi